India, April 29 -- Pakistan has recently banned Indian airlines from using its airspace. While airspace closure may seem simple, several nuances behind such restrictions can greatly affect flight operations. So, what does airspace closure mean, and how will it impact travel?

What does the Pakistan airspace ban mean for India?
The Pakistan airspace ban is in effect until May 23, 2025 | Representational image credit: Khalid Marwat/Flickr
